About

Undercity of Sin is a single player role playing game with anime, science fiction and erotic themes. It was developed by Manten Kobo and was released on December 5, 2025. It received mostly positive reviews from players.

Experience a story of crime and gang warfare as you fight your way through eight procedurally generated dungeons full of machine soldiers and superpowered weaponry, and explore a skill tree with numerous ways to power up your character as you overcome this traditional turn-based RPG.

  • Strong cyberpunk yakuza theme with a compelling corruption storyline featuring a busty tsundere protagonist.
  • High-quality anime-style artwork and varied outfit designs that impact H-scenes; well-crafted defeat and battle erotica visuals.
  • Atmospheric music and partial voice acting enhance immersion; the game offers a large amount of H-content with multiple lewdness stages encouraging replayability.
  • Randomly generated dungeons are repetitive, bland, and tedious to navigate, detracting from gameplay enjoyment.
  • Combat is slow and can feel like a slog due to high enemy density and lack of fast-forward options; the system is somewhat generic and poorly balanced.
  • Art style inconsistencies due to multiple artists contribute to uneven quality in H-scenes, and the supporting cast lacks proper visual representation and depth.
  • story
    22 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The story is a fairly typical neo-Tokyo yakuza corruption narrative, centered on survival and debt repayment, with a comical tone and predictable plot progression. While thematically interesting, especially in its depiction of corruption without negative consequences, the story lacks depth, meaningful twists, and multiple endings, which some players found detrimental. It is best suited for those who appreciate the genre's erotic elements and thematic focus rather than a complex or engaging narrative.

  • graphics
    16 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The graphics feature a distinctive anime-style with detailed characters and backgrounds that create a unique atmosphere, especially in key erotic scenes. However, inconsistencies arise due to multiple artists contributing differing art styles, leading to noticeable shifts within scenes and some reused CGs. While dungeon visuals lack variety, the overall art quality and thematic visuals remain a strong point that enhances the game's appeal.

  • gameplay
    13 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The gameplay is generally solid but tends to be repetitive and unoriginal, blending familiar turn-based combat with exploration and erotic events. Critics note that the integration of corruption mechanics feels weak and that dungeon crawling can be tedious and lengthy. Overall, it offers a typical experience within its genre without introducing innovative or particularly engaging gameplay elements.
